New York: Hawthorn Books, Inc, 1963. Revised edition. Cloth. Very Good/Very Good. 8vo. Hinge of endpapers with strip of scotch tape (to repair cracking) and strip of heavy tape to title page and frontis gutter. Cloth with some very light rubbing to extremities. Dust-jacket with small nicks and wear to head and heel of spine, some wear to several corners, and a few tiny nicks to edges; lightly rubbed in a few places.
